Connecting the appliance
Before moving the RO 400 into its permanent place,
remove the three protection caps and the protector under
the prefilters. Then connect the three hoses to the
appliance as shown in Fig. C.
Connect the purified water hose from the purified water
spigot to the appliance. Press this end of the hose all the
way home, as far as the line marked on it 11/16” (about
17 mm). Use the elbow (supplied) if space is restricted
behind the appliance.
Connect the end of the reject water hose (the one with
the bend) to the appliance, and secure it with one of the
hose clips supplied. Next screw the correct end of the
feed water hose onto the appliance. You can now turn
on the water supply by opening the valve, to check that
this coupling is fully watertight. Connect the wiring for
the indicator lights on the spigot, then move the
appliance carefully into its permanent location.
Electrical connection
For your safety, the water purifier must be
grounded. If there is a malfunction or breakdown,
grounding will reduce risk of electrical shock. This
product has a power cord with a 3-prong grounding
plug. It must be plugged into a matching 3-prong
grounding type receptacle, installed and grounded in
accordance with the National Electric Code and
any local codes and ordinances.
Connect the electrical plug to the wall socket (Fig. D).
The appliance will now start working (flushing). The
appliance carries out this flushing operation every time it
is reconnected to the power supply.
No water from the appliance should be consumed
until you have followed the full "Flushing procedure"
and "Calibration", as described on the next page.
After installing and testing the appliance, turn on the
appliance's drinking water spigot and check that all the
connections are watertight. If any coupling is leaking,
disconnect the electrical plug, then tighten the hose clip
or nut more. Connect the appliance to the power supply
again. When the appliance has been installed for one
week, tighten the connections for the reject water and
feed water hoses again.
Avoid fire hazard or electrical shock. Do not use an
adapter plug, extension cord or remove grounding
prong from electrical power cord. Failure to follow
this warning can cause serious injury, fire or death.

A leakage as small as just a few drops of water
is enough to start the water purifier working
(when it is not needed).
Leakages outside the actual appliance cannot
be detected by its leakage protection system.
Unless specifically stated otherwise in these
instructions, the valve on the feed water supply
pipe should be left in the open position for the
protection system of the RO 400 to function.
